Sumario:In this article, Thomas Pogge anwers to the critics of Joshua Cohen. In this\norder, he inquiries what is the appropriate standard of proof for evaluating the Strong\nThesis, he presents and examines specific reform proposals of the global order ?such\nas the elimination of protectionist barriers from rich countries, the modification of global\nrules governing resource extraction and the creation of a Health Impact Fund?, and\nhe analyses the impact that this reforms could have on global poverty and inequality
